    This film chronicles the ultimate demise of Hitler’s legendary west wall, dubbed by the allies as the ‘Siegfried Line’. The West Wall was a tremendous barrier of fortified defenses and minefields, protecting Germany from invasion through Europe. In 1944, this line of defense was crushed, when following the D Day landings; the allied troops fought their way relentlessly to cross the line into Germany.

    By 1944, the Westwall had been stripped of its barbed wire & mines which were sent to the Atlantik Wall...The keys to many of the bunkers couldn't be found either, and the firing ports couldn't accommodate the newer weapons...The men themselves were a mixed bunch from all branches of the Wehrmacht retreating from France and Belgium...The fact that they were able to hold the Westwall at all is impressive soldiering...
